Automation and Artificial Intelligence at Work
The most impactful forces that are changing the work environments are automation and artificial intelligence. Repetitive and data-driven tasks can be now executed by machines and software at a high speed and precision enabling companies to boost efficiency and minimize operational costs.
Nonetheless, this change entails challenges as well. This is due to some job positions being eliminated particularly those that are routine. Meanwhile, the development of AI, machine learning, and data analysis are becoming new jobs.
Instead of substituting humans with technologies, they are altering the character of work. The workers are currently supposed to work on those jobs that demand creativity, emotional intelligence and complex decision-making which machines cannot easily imitate. Telecommuting and online group work tools
Remote work has altered the workplace dynamics greatly. The employees are now able to work together at various locations without necessarily being at a working office due to the advanced communication tools. This has made it a significant benefit to the workers and employers.
The benefits of this include reduced overhead costs to the companies and better balance of work and life to the employees. Remote collaboration has never been more efficient than with the use of digital tools like video conferencing, project management platforms, and cloud-based systems.
Although these are advantageous, there are still challenges. Team communication, productivity and cybersecurity risk management are some areas that need proper planning and adaptation. Organizations are continually perfecting their remote work plans in order to counter such problems.
Shifting Skills Requirements and Lifelong learning
Due to the development of technology, new skills are becoming more demanded. Such technical capabilities as coding, data analysis, and digital literacy are being crucial in most industries. Meanwhile, such soft skills as communication, adaptability, and critical thinking are also crucial.
Life-long learning is no longer a choice. In order to stay relevant in a fast changing job market, employees need to continually upgrade their skills. With the introduction of online learning platform systems and professional training systems, skill development has been strengthened.
Employers are also undertaking training and development programs to develop a more competent workforce. This emphasis on learning also makes organizations remain competitive and facilitates employee development.
Expanding the Gig Economy and Flexible Work Models
The gig economy is growing as it becomes easier to work on your own with the help of digital platforms. Flexibility and autonomy are on the increase with freelancing, contract work, and jobs based on projects, which provides workers with flexibility and autonomy.
To companies, this model offers them a diversified talent pool without the commitment of full-time employment. It enables businesses to flex up their staff according to the project requirements.
Nevertheless, gig work is associated with such drawbacks as unstable income and benefits deficit. With the trend on the increase, the debates on worker rights and protections are gaining more significance.
The place of technology in workplace transformation
Technology is not only altering the job positions it is also altering the way organizations are run. Digital tools are simplifying the work processes, communications, and decision-making. The use of data-driven strategies is emerging prominently in business activities.
The new technologies of virtual reality and augmented reality are starting to impact training and teamwork. Such tools have the ability to form immersive experiences, which make the learning process and collaboration more interesting.
Moreover, cybersecurity has emerged as a very important issue. With the increased use of digital systems in the workplace, data security and secure operation is a requisite.
